This is not a good approach, especially from a change management perspective. A change should not be automatically closed immediately; it should only be closed after the Review state is completed. The reason is that the change must go through the PIR process.
Also, what happens if an agent fails to update the state of a change even though the change was implemented successfully? And what about changes that look successful on paper, but fail in reality? Are we going to revert those even though the change was marked as unsuccessful?
There are many open points here. We should first focus on defining and fixing the process. Once the process is clearly set up, then we can move forward with a technical solution.
